Allianz Insurance Lanka Ltd entered into an agreement with Asiri Health,  to offer a multitude of value additions and benefits to its customers.

With this partnership, Allianz Lanka policyholders will have access to a wide array of benefits ranging from discounts on room rates, laboratory tests and other diagnostic services,complimentary ambulance pick up for admissions within a 10km radius of the hospital and complimentary access to a range of clinics including consultation clinics for spine and back pain, heart, breast care, neurology (brain & spine), well-woman care and early pregnancy. 

All policyholders can avail themselves of these benefits at Asiri Group of Hospitals, located in key areas around the country. Motor and non-motor policy holders will benefit via discounts on laboratory testing and free/discount vouchers to certain health clinics through this partnership.

CEO and Director of Allianz Insurance Lanka Ltd., Gany Subramaniam said, “We at Allianz have remained committed to helping secure people’s lives and offering our customers an enhanced service experience. We believe, through this partnership with Asiri Health, that our policyholders will not only have access to the well-reputed healthcare services the hospital is renowned for, but with personalised service being offered, each policyholder will be ensured a hassle-free experience.”
